Let’s talk about general liability insurance. General liability is the foundation of any commercial insurance program. It defends you if your business operation causes bodily injury or property damage to other people and their stuff. It can provide that coverage on your premise or if you’re in the business of servicing or installing, it can provide that protection off your premise.

If you’re in the business of selling something, it could also provide that protection if your product harms someone. If your business is found negligent, the policy can provide protection against that financial loss. General liability does not provide coverage for your stuff or your people. For that, you have commercial property insurance or worker’s compensation. Two completely separate policies.
